Across TCGA cell cohorts, UBR1 RNA expression is significantly associated with the go_rna of many other GO terms, with 3,808 significant associations in total. BLOOD_Leukemia shows the largest number of these associations.

The most reproducible UBR1-associated GO terms across cancer lineages are Ubiquitin-dependent protein catabolic process via the N-end rule pathway, Cytosolic transport, and Viral translational termination-reinitiation. Each is linked with UBR1 in more than 19 cancer types. Because this analysis shows association rather than direction, both UBR1-to-partner and partner-to-UBR1 results are reported.
